Android 动画
补间动画,控制一个image的缩放和透明度。
<?xml version="1.0" encoding="utf-8"?>
<set xmlns:android="http://schemas.android.com/apk/res/android"
android:repeatCount="infinite"> // android:repeatCount="infinite" 设置动画重复次数(infinite 表示重复无数次)
<scale //缩放
android:fromXScale="1.0" //fromXScale、fromYScale 动画开始时view大小(1.0表示原大小)
android:fromYScale="1.0"
android:toXScale="4.0" //toXScale、toYScale view放大倍数
android:toYScale="4.0"
android:pivotX="50%" //pivotX、pivotY 动画开始时基准(都设置为50%时在正中开始)
android:pivotY="50%"
android:repeatCount="infinite"
android:duration="1000"/> //duration 动画持续时间
<alpha //透明度
android:fromAlpha="1.0"
android:toAlpha="0.0"
android:repeatCount="infinite"
android:duration="1000"/>
</set>
然后,给白色圆点(imageview)设置上这个动画就可以出现圆从小变大,逐渐透明的效果,就像叠加一样地在它上面添加一个不变的白点就是一个闪闪的标签啦~